    WR Trent Sherfield agrees to a one-year deal with Vikings

    The Vikings have agreed to terms with receiver Trent Sherfield on a one-year deal worth $1.79 million, Alec Lewis of TheAthletic.com reports.
    Sherfield, 28, excels as a blocker and a core special teams player.
    He played 392 offensive snaps and 150 on special teams in 17 games last season. Sherfield caught 11 passes for 86 yards and a touchdown and made three tackles.
